Position

White: king f4; knight f3; pawns a3/b4/d4/g4/h5. Black: king f6; bishop d1; pawns a4/b5/d5/e6/h6. Material is balanced. White to move.

Solution (2 moves)

  1. Opponent setup: Bxf3 — bishop d1→f3, captures knight. Now White to move.
  2. Best move: Kxf3 — king f4→f3, captures bishop. Opponent replies e5 (pawn e6→e5).
  3. Best move: dxe5+ — pawn d4→e5, captures pawn, gives check.

Tactical themes

endgame, equality, short. The key move dxe5+ captures with check, forcing a response.
